Not a bad introduction so far, but does do that irritating thing that many "primers" do of assuming that some terms of art are so basic that everyone is born knowing them. "Modernism" is used frequently to compare other schools of thought to, but not defined until chapter 7. "Realism" is even more frequently used and never defined at all. It's a minor point: you have to draw the line somewhere with assumed prior knowledge and I can look these things up, but it does disrupt the flow of reading. It would be better if a little bit of the introduction was given over to expected prior knowledge, and/or a glossary given for terms considered too basic to cover in the main text.
